Proud to match @VicGovAu & invest $10m for Australia’s 1st Centre of Excellence in Paramedicine. Based at VU Sunshine, it'll train 1000s of parameds & be a hub of learning, research & industry collaboration. @AmbulanceVic @AdamShoemakerVC @MaryAnneThomas
vu.edu.au
VU and the Victorian Government jointly announced a $20 million investment to establish Australia’s first Centre of Excellence in Paramedicine.
